You a .7z archive into a .3ds file because they are different file types: one is a compressed folder (7z) and the other is a disk image or 3D model (3ds). To get the .3ds file, you must extract it from the archive. How to "Convert" (Extract) 7z to 3ds Extract the archive : Use a tool like 7-Zip or WinZip .

A 7z file is a compressed archive created by the open-source 7-Zip software. Think of it as a digital cardboard box that has been tightly packed to take up less storage space. It can hold any file type inside it, including documents, videos, images, or console files.
